Fresh and vibrant: This Port Askaig was inspired by spring. The bottling is characterized by two different vintage whiskies from a distillery on the northeast coast of Islay, near the village of Port Askaig. A total of 18 ex-Bourbon hogsheads from 2006 and 2007 were used for this multifaceted single malt, which was bottled in spring 2020.
The Spring Edition tastes harmonious: The sweetness of stone fruit and toffee is balanced by peaty smoke and campfire aroma. Mineral-maritime and citrus notes, dried mint, and the aroma of freshly mown grass create a spring-like mood. A refreshing treat – just in time for the start of summer!
Distillery Information
The port town of Port Askaig is the gateway to the whisky island of Islay. For hundreds of years, it has offered fans of the water of life and curious explorers access to the whisky region of the same name – and to its unmistakable single malts. A strongly smoky, peaty taste paired with sweet, fruity aromas – this is typical for many of the famous Islay whiskies. And it is precisely these that the independent bottler Port Askaig has dedicated itself to. Its goal: Islay Single Malts that capture the unique character of the island – with smoky notes, associations of salty sea breeze, and a hint of seaweed. There are currently nine active distilleries in the Islay whisky region. Which ones Port Askaig's bottlings come from is unknown – despite many rumors and conjectures. In 2009, the renowned whisky expert Sukhinder Singh founded the Port Askaig brand. He recently pointed out that he now works with three different Islay distilleries for his whiskies. Which ones exactly remains his secret. The taste of Port Askaig whiskies is typical of Islay Single Malts: The peat used to dry the malt provides light to strong smoky aromas. And also the typical maritime notes with hints of seaweed – which emerge when the peat cut on Islay is burned. To preserve the unadulterated character of the distillates, the bottlings are neither colored nor chill-filtered. Many of Port Askaig's batches are also limited.
